The ending of 'Marjorie Morningstar' hit me like a slow-motion punch. Marjorie doesn’t 'win' in the traditional sense—she doesn’t become a famous actress or end up with the dazzling but unreliable Noel. Instead, she chooses safety over passion, and the novel leaves you wondering if that’s wisdom or defeat. Wouk doesn’t judge her, but he doesn’t romanticize her path either. It’s one of those endings that sticks with you because it feels so real, like catching up with an old friend who’s both happier and sadder than you expected.

Marjorie Morningstar ends with a bittersweet realization of dreams deferred and the compromises of adulthood. After years of chasing her theatrical ambitions and romantic ideals—embodied by her turbulent relationship with Noel Airman—Marjorie ultimately settles into a conventional life. She marries a stable, kind man (not Noel), has children, and becomes a suburban housewife, far removed from the bohemian world she once idolized. The novel’s closing scenes reflect on the quiet resignation of her choices, contrasting her youthful fire with the pragmatic contentment of middle age.

What’s striking is how Herman Wouk frames her arc not as a failure but as a nuanced evolution. Marjorie’s 'morningstar' persona—her stage name and symbol of her artistic aspirations—fades into memory, but the story lingers on the question of whether her compromise was inevitable or a surrender. The ending resonates because it’s neither tragic nor triumphant; it’s achingly human. Marjorie Morningstar' is one of those classic novels that feels timeless, and I totally get why you'd want to dive into it. Herman Wouk’s storytelling is just so immersive—it’s like stepping into Marjorie’s world and growing up alongside her. Now, about reading it online for free: I’ve hunted around a bit, and while it’s tricky to find legitimate free copies (since it’s still under copyright), there are some options. Public libraries often have digital lending systems like OverDrive or Libby where you can borrow the ebook for free with a library card. Some universities also provide access through their libraries if you’re a student. Project Gutenberg is a go-to for older public domain works, but 'Marjorie Morningstar' isn’t there yet. If you’re okay with audiobooks, sometimes platforms like YouTube or Internet Archive have readings, though quality varies. I’d also recommend checking out used bookstores or thrift shops—sometimes you can snag a cheap physical copy. And hey, if you’re into classic coming-of-age stories, you might enjoy 'A Tree Grows in Brooklyn' or 'The Bell Jar' while you’re at it. They’ve got that same blend of personal growth and societal pressures. Just a heads-up, though: avoid sketchy sites claiming to offer free downloads. They’re usually pirated, and supporting authors matters. Wouk’s work deserves the respect of a legit purchase or borrow.
